# Selected rules and regulations for daily management of dormitory hygiene 1#

In order to ensure that the sanitary area of the staff dormitory is clean and beautiful, and create a clean, beautiful and comfortable rest environment for all staff, this implementation plan is specially formulated.

First, the scope of health responsibility

1. The indoor sanitation of each dormitory shall be cleaned by the residents in turn, and the personal area sanitation shall be undertaken by them.

2. The dormitory wardrobe for personal use is cleaned by the users themselves.

Bedding and pillows should be cleaned regularly.

Second, the health management requirements

1. During the check-in, employees should keep the dormitory environment clean and take turns to clean it (the rotating table is attached behind the door). The administration department will inspect and supervise the dormitories from time to time. If it is found that individual beds do not pay special attention to personal hygiene, they will be posted on the bulletin board in the form of photos, and those who have been announced by the administrative department for more than two times will be fined 30 yuan/time according to the company's dormitory management regulations as a warning.

2. The dormitory hygiene should be "eight cleanness" and "six cleanness". "Eight cleanness" refers to floors, walls, wardrobes, doors and windows, glass, beds, bathrooms, washbasins, etc. Be scrubbed clean every day. "Six noes" means no dust, no phlegm, no water, no scraps of paper, no shells and no peculiar smell. Offenders will be fined 20 ~ 50 yuan/time depending on the seriousness of the case.

3. Bedding should be "trinity": every day, bedding should be neatly stacked, sheets should be flat and tidy, and pillows should be neatly placed. Offenders will be fined 5~ 10 yuan/time depending on the circumstances.

4, keep the wall clean, do "four noes", and "four chaos" is strictly prohibited. That is, no cobwebs, no stains, no hands or footprints. Nailing, hanging sundries, pasting calligraphy and painting, and pulling rope are strictly prohibited. Offenders shall be fined 5 ~ 20 yuan/time depending on the circumstances.

5, the use and storage of electrical appliances, switch the fan as required, it is strictly prohibited to burn lamps day and night, long fan phenomenon. If the electrical appliance is abnormal or damaged, it should be repaired in time and the responsibility should be explained. Turn off the lights when people leave the dormitory. Offenders shall be fined 5~20 yuan/time depending on the circumstances.

6. Pay attention to indoor ventilation. Open and close the window according to the weather every day. Open the window for ventilation in normal weather.

7. Indoor garbage must be bagged every day and sent to the trash can in time. No indoor garbage is allowed to be cleaned and piled up in the corridor. Offenders shall be fined 5~20 yuan/time depending on the circumstances.

8. Keep the dormitory, corridor, stairs and handrails clean. No littering, no bubble gum spitting, no wall painting, no sewage splashing, etc. Offenders shall be fined 5~20 yuan/time depending on the circumstances.

9, keep the bathroom, bathroom and bathroom hygiene. Rinse with water after defecation. Shampoo and other packaging bags should be put in the dustbin. If the sewer mouth is blocked, it should be removed in time.

10. It is forbidden to keep livestock, poultry or pets inside and outside the dormitory. Offenders will be dealt with within 2 days.

1 1. The articles placed in the dormitory should be arranged by the dormitory staff. Anyone who leaves personal belongings and litters in the dormitory will be exposed and fined 50 yuan three times in a row.

12. In front of each dormitory, three bags of garbage are dumped into the trash can in the designated corridor, and 30 yuan is fined for throwing garbage downstairs at will every time.

Three, health examination and assessment management

1. The Administration Department shall conduct a comprehensive inspection of the dormitory area at least twice a week. Violation of dormitory management regulations and health management system shall be handled according to company regulations, and daily inspection shall be made for notification.

2. The company selects the best dormitory and the worst dormitory every month, and the administration department is responsible for organizing specific work according to the following provisions:

(1) working procedure

(1) Determine the monthly centralized assessment time and the list of inspectors.

(2) Prepare all kinds of materials needed for assessment, such as score sheet and dormitory distribution sheet.

③ Dormitory inspection.

⑤ Summarize the score sheet and organize special personnel to make statistics.

⑤ Report the statistical results and rewards and punishments to the company.

⑥ Inform the examination results and rewards and punishments records.

⑦ File arrangement

(2) Evaluation method

According to the detailed rules of health appraisal, according to the comprehensive inspection results of this dormitory (score 80%) and daily inspection records (score 20%), the "excellent dormitory of this month" was selected.

(3) Scoring standard of dormitory hygiene: ① Overall, the layout is reasonable, the original placement position of the company's articles has not moved, and towels, toothbrushes, pots and pans are placed in a centralized and unified manner; Do not hang clothes, pull ropes or wires. Single unqualified 1~3 points.

② Floor: The indoor floor is clean, free of garbage, paper scraps and stagnant water, and the shoes are neatly placed. The wastebasket was emptied in time. After people left, the stools were all placed under the table neatly. Single unqualified 1~3 points.

③ Wall surface: The wall surface is clean, free from traces, graffiti, nails and cobwebs. Single unqualified 1~3 points.

(4) Paving: the quilt is standardized and folded, evenly placed, and the pillow towel and bed sheet are flat; There are no sundries on the bed, and clothes are put in the closet or on the balcony. Single unqualified 1~3 points.

⑤ Desk: Commonly used items are placed neatly; The desktop is clean, without sundries, and the items are sorted neatly. Single unqualified 1~3 points.

⑥ Bathroom: items are hung neatly; Pool, ground clean without water; There is no smell in the bathroom, and there are no clothes that have been soaked for a long time. Single unqualified 1~3 points.

⑦ Others: Keep the indoor air fresh and free of peculiar smell; Doors and windows are clean, wires are selflessly connected, and electricity is not used illegally. Single unqualified 1~3 points.

# Selected rules and regulations for daily management of dormitory hygiene 8#

In order to create a good study and living environment for students in our college, cultivate students' good living and health habits, and give full play to the civilized education function of dormitory. Formulate the "Regulations on Hygienic Management of Dormitories in the Institute of Mechanical and Electrical Engineering".

First, the health responsibility system

The hygiene of students' dormitory is managed by five levels: deputy secretary of the General Party Branch, secretary of the General League Branch, counselor, class committee (mainly monitor and health committee) and dormitory director. The deputy secretary of the General Party Branch and the secretary of the Communist Youth League Branch go to the dormitory to check the health status from time to time, and the counselors regularly go to the dormitory in charge of the grade (class) to supervise the health cleaning and understand the students' ideological and living conditions. The class committee should effectively organize the sanitary cleaning work of the dormitory of the class, and the head of the dormitory should lead all dormitory members to do a good job in dormitory hygiene.

Second, the duty and cleaning system

Dormitory hygiene implements the duty system and cleaning system, and it should be cleaned once a day and once a week (every Thursday). The head of the dormitory is responsible for putting the duty list, grading standards and college management system on the wall, and the responsibility lies with people; The students on duty should clean the whole room according to the hygienic standard, and urge every member of the dormitory to tidy up his own house.

Third, check the assessment system.

1, dormitory hygiene adopts regular and irregular inspection methods. The general health inspection of the whole hospital is scheduled at noon every Thursday, and the participants include counselors, student union cadres and class health Committee members. The sanitary inspection in the apartment center is irregular.

2. The final score of dormitory hygiene inspection and appraisal is obtained from the total inspection score of the college (60%) and the random inspection score of the college leaders and counselors (40%), and finally the scores of A, B, C and III are obtained in proportion.
